msxml6.h 标头

此标头由 XML HTTP 扩展请求使用。 有关详细信息,请参阅:

msxml6.h 包含以下编程接口:

接口

 
IXMLHTTPRequest2

提供配置和发送 HTTP 请求所需的方法和属性,并使用回调在 HTTP 响应处理期间接收通知。 请注意,Windows Phone 8.1 支持此接口。  .
IXMLHTTPRequest2Callback

定义回调,用于向应用程序发出未完成的 IXMLHTTPRequest2 请求来通知影响 HTTP 请求和响应处理的事件。 请注意,Windows Phone 8.1 支持此接口。  .
IXMLHTTPRequest3

提供配置和发送 HTTP 请求所需的方法和属性,并使用回调在 HTTP 响应处理期间接收通知。
IXMLHTTPRequest3Callback

定义回调,用于向应用程序发出未完成的 IXMLHTTPRequest3 请求来通知影响 HTTP 请求和响应处理的事件。

結構

 
XHR_CERT

定义指向编码证书的缓冲区。
XHR_COOKIE

定义一个 Cookie,可以通过调用 SetCookie 方法或通过调用 GetCookie 方法从 HTTP Cookie jar 中检索到 HTTP Cookie jar 来添加到 HTTP Cookie jar。

枚举

 
XHR_AUTH

指定是允许身份验证用于连接到代理还是连接到 HTTP 服务器。
XHR_CERT_ERROR_FLAG

定义在 SSL 协商期间通过处理 IXMLHTTPRequest3Callback 接口上的 OnServerCertificateReceived 方法来指示服务器证书错误的标志。
XHR_CERT_IGNORE_FLAG

定义可以分配给传出 HTTP 请求的标志,以便通过在 IXMLHTTPRequest3 接口上调用 SetProperty 方法来忽略某些证书错误。
XHR_COOKIE_FLAG

定义一组标志,通过调用 GetCookie 方法,从 HTTP Cookie jar 调用 SetCookie 方法或查询,可以分配给 HTTP Cookie jar 中的 Cookie。
XHR_COOKIE_STATE

指定 Cookie 的状态。
XHR_CRED_PROMPT

指定是否允许用户进行身份验证的凭据提示。
XHR_PROPERTY

定义可以通过调用 SetProperty 方法分配给传出 HTTP 请求的属性。